The HG-10(*) VFO can be very stable.

I used one for a couple of years with my HW-16.

However, the stability is dependent to a great degree on the condition 
of the oscillator tube, the 6CH8.

I had to try several NIB ones before I found one that suited my idea of 
stability, even on 40 meters.

The difference in both long and short-term stability, and to keying 
quality, due to just the tube was quite striking.

Once I found a good one, the quality of the VFO never changed while I 
used it.

It is a good rig. The only thing I didn't like about it is that it doesn't cover 
160 meters. So now I use a VF-1 with my HW-16 and other rigs. It is 
equally as stable as the HG-10 when properly restored. Besides, as I've 
said before, I really like the funky green dial.
